How long is EOD training?

EOD School (42 weeks) – After successfully completing dive school, candidates transfer to Naval Explosive Ordnance Disposal School at Eglin Air Force Base in Fort Walton Beach, FL. This training comes in four sections, each teaching how to render safe or defuse specific types of ordnance.

How long does it take to become an infantry Marine?

Complete training at the School of Infantry after Basic Training. Follow your instructor’s directions and maintain a positive attitude to master the 59-day course that provides new Marines training in their Infantry MOS which is 0311.

How fast do Marines have to run 3 miles?

Males must complete the three-mile run in 28 minutes or less. Females must complete the three-mile run in 31 minutes or less.

How many pushups does a Marine have to do?

If Marines choose pushups, the best they can score is a 70. Men between the ages of 21 and 25 will need 87 pushups to earn max points. Marine women aged 26-30 would need 50 pushups to get the maximum 70 points . In comparison, soldiers need between 71 and 77 for a max score of 100 points on the Army’s fitness test.

Is a 95 on the ASVAB good?

The scores you receive on the other six content areas of the ASVAB are used to determine which job in the military would be best suited for you. Your AFQT scores are reported as percentiles which range 1-99. … If you receive a percentile score of 95, you have scored as well or better than 95% of other test takers.

How do I become an EOD tech?


QUALIFICATIONS SUMMARY

  1. MINIMUM EDUCATION. High school diploma, GED with 15 college credits, or GED.
  2. ASVAB REQUIREMENTS. General; Mechanical.
  3. QUALIFICATIONS. Height must be no less than 62 inches and no more than 80 inches. Successful completion of the EOD Physical Ability and Stamina Test.
